Czy może pracować bez if?

Instrukcja if sprawdza każdą rzecz w nawiasach i jeśli jest prawdziwa, wykonuje blok kodu, który następuje. Jeśli wymagasz, aby kod działał tylko wtedy, gdy instrukcja zwróci wartość true (i nie rób nic innego, jeśli false), wówczas instrukcja else nie jest potrzebna.

Co to znaczy else bez poprzedniego if?

Ten błąd: „else” bez poprzedniego „if” występuje, gdy używasz instrukcji else po zakończeniu instrukcji if, tj. instrukcji if kończy się średnikiem. if…else instrukcje mają swój własny blok i dlatego te instrukcje nie kończą się.

Co oznacza oczekiwany „)” w Javie?

oczekiwany Ten błąd występuje, gdy kod jest pisany poza metodą; jest to zazwyczaj spowodowane błędem w nawiasach klamrowych. Rozważmy następujący przykład: public class Test { System.out.println(“Hello!” ); public static void main(String[] args) { System.out.println("Świat!"

Co to jest błąd .class w Javie?

Błąd to podklasa Throwable, która wskazuje na poważne problemy, których rozsądna aplikacja nie powinna próbować wyłapać. Większość takich błędów to nienormalne warunki. Błąd ThreadDeath, chociaż jest „normalnym” stanem, jest również podklasą błędu, ponieważ większość aplikacji nie powinna próbować go złapać.

Jak naprawić błąd bez jeśli?

Przykład 1: Brak instrukcji If Następnie napotykamy słowo kluczowe Else, ale nie było przed nim instrukcji If. To rzeczywiście spowoduje błąd kompilatora: Inaczej Bez Jeżeli. Aby rozwiązać ten problem, wystarczy dodać instrukcję If. Instrukcja If składa się z If [warunek] Then .

Czy możemy napisać oświadczenie if bez innego?

Możesz użyć instrukcji if bez innego.

Czy może istnieć instrukcja else bez poprzedzającej go instrukcji i if?

Tak to mozliwe. Nie możesz pisać inaczej bez warunku if. Warunek if sprawdza, czy Twoje oświadczenie jest prawdziwe czy fałszywe. Jeśli stwierdzenie jest prawdziwe, warunek „if” zostanie wykonany, w przeciwnym razie program przestanie działać (jeśli nie podałeś warunku else).

Czy mogę użyć innego bez, jeśli w Pythonie?

W większości języków programowania (C/C++, Java, itp.) użycie instrukcji else zostało ograniczone do instrukcji warunkowych if. Ale Python pozwala nam również na użycie warunku else z pętlami for. Blok else tuż po for/while jest wykonywany tylko wtedy, gdy pętla NIE jest zakończona instrukcją break.

Co to jest niedozwolony start typu w Javie?

Błąd niedozwolonego początku wyrażenia java jest błędem dynamicznym, co oznacza, że ​​można go napotkać w czasie kompilacji za pomocą instrukcji „javac” (kompilator Java). Ten błąd jest generowany, gdy kompilator wykryje jakąkolwiek instrukcję niezgodną z regułami lub składnią języka Java.

Czy w razie potrzeby jest jeszcze coś innego?

Nie, nie jest wymagane napisanie części else dla instrukcji if. W rzeczywistości większość programistów woli i zaleca unikanie blokady else. To wyłącznie kwestia stylu i przejrzystości. Łatwo sobie wyobrazić zdania, szczególnie te proste, dla których inny byłby zbyteczny.

Czy możesz mieć, jeśli bez innego Pythona?

Metoda 1: Jednowierszowa instrukcja If Pierwsza jest również najprostszą metodą: jeśli chcesz jednowierszową instrukcję bez instrukcji else, po prostu napisz instrukcję if w jednym wierszu! Istnieje wiele sztuczek (takich jak używanie średnika), które pomagają tworzyć jednowierszowe wypowiedzi.

Czy jest jeszcze konieczne po if?

Jak piszesz kody bez jeśli inaczej?

tzn. równie dobrze mógłbyś napisać bool isSmall = i < 10; – to właśnie unika instrukcji if, a nie oddzielnej funkcji. Kod postaci if (test) { x = true; } inny { x = fałsz; } lub if (test) { return true; } else { return false; } jest zawsze głupie; po prostu użyj x = test lub zwróć test .

Dlaczego Java mówi inaczej bez jeśli?

„else” bez „if” Ten błąd oznacza, że ​​Java nie może znaleźć instrukcji if powiązanej z instrukcją else. Instrukcje Else nie działają, chyba że są powiązane z instrukcją if. Upewnij się, że masz instrukcję if i że instrukcja else nie jest zagnieżdżona w instrukcji if.

Jaki jest oczekiwany błąd w Javie?

oczekiwano” Ten błąd występuje, gdy czegoś brakuje w kodzie. Często jest to spowodowane brakiem średnika lub nawiasem zamykającym. Często ten komunikat o błędzie nie wskazuje dokładnej lokalizacji problemu.